Implement workaround for flex --header-file option

This is fixed in automake 1.12 and later.

The problem is that the ylwrap helper script creates a temporary directory
when running flex. Flex then correctly creates the scanner.h file inside this
temporary directory, but ylwrap does not copy it back to the build dir.
